Kwadwo Nkansah, also known as Lil Win, who is working to revitalize the Ghanaian film business, has said that his rise to prominence in the industry came at the right moment.
Speaking on UTV's Showbiz Night, the actor denied claims that Agya Koo was demoted so he could shine, saying that he never received a golden opportunity to ascend but instead had to earn his way up.
He thinks that performers who came before him had their day in the spotlight.
Nobody can forecast the future; I had to use my time. It was my time, but legends like Agya Koo, Mr. Beautiful, and Apostle John Prah rose before me.
You can check the date: ‘Dakyen asem nti', my very first film, was a success. On set, I used to give the crew my takeout check and distribute biscuits to everyone. I was that giving.
